It’s ready! After several months (jeez a year!) of planning, we are ready to announce the launch of Ostera Life Skills Academy and Campus Living for neurodiverse young adults. This nonprofit organization is designed to support high functioning neurodiverse young adults as they progress from high school graduation to independent living by teaching life skills in real world situations and offering campus style living to foster the experience of taking the next steps of leaving home. Designed to give neurodiverse young adults a supportive and supervised environment among their peers, Ostera aims to prepare these young adults to successfully launch into adulthood.
We will be collaborating with local resources to support these young adults through the process of securing employment to enter the workforce and/or navigating college as their next step, learning to drive, budget, grocery shop and cook while balancing work/school life. Our vision is onsite counselors and mental health specialists who are trained in guiding the neurodiverse population and their families in reaching their goals of independently living and working.
